Tsogt-Ovoo vs Araxa Climate & Distance Between

Brazil flag
  • The distance between Tsogt-Ovoo, Mongolia and Araxa, Brazil is approximately 16,246 km or 10,095 mi.
  • To reach Tsogt-Ovoo in this distance one would set out from Araxa bearing 36.6°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Tsogt-Ovoo bearing 128.1° or SE .
  • Tsogt-Ovoo has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Araxa has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
  • Tsogt-Ovoo is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ome whereas Araxa is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 16.8 °C (30.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 32.8 °C (59°F) more in Tsogt-Ovoo.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1475.7 mm (58.1 in) less which is equivalent to 1475.7 l/m² (36.22 US gal/ft²) or 14,757,000 l/ha (1,577,621 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.8° lower in Tsogt-Ovoo than in Araxa.
